micro:bit Gateway İndir
Bilgi
Yenilikler
Endikasyon aktive: BLE Göstergesi (Varsayılan)
Endikasyon inaktive: BLE Bildirim
Sessiz aktive: Hayır görsel günlüğü
Sessiz inaktive: Günlüğü
Koşullar:
- Min. Android 4.4
- Bluetooth Düşük Enerji (BLE)
- Eşleştirilmiş cihazlar
- Mikro: (kendiniz tarafından geliştirilmiştir) bit programm
MBED Örnek:
#include "MicroBit.h"
#include "MicroBitUARTService.h"
MICROBIT UBIT;
MicroBitUARTService * uart;
int = 0 bağlı;
void onConnected (MicroBitEvent e)
{
uBit.display.scroll ( "C");
= 1 bağlantılı;
}
void onDisconnected (MicroBitEvent e)
{
uBit.display.scroll ( "D");
= 0 bağlantılı;
}
void onButtonA (MicroBitEvent e)
{
eğer (bağlı == 0) {
uBit.display.scroll ( "NC");
dönüş;
}
uart-> ( "Evet") göndermek;
uBit.display.scroll ( "Y");
}
void onButtonB (MicroBitEvent e)
{
eğer (bağlı == 0) {
uBit.display.scroll ( "NC");
dönüş;
}
uart-> ( "Hayır") göndermek;
uBit.display.scroll ( "N");
}
void onButtonAB (MicroBitEvent e)
{
eğer (bağlı == 0) {
uBit.display.scroll ( "NC");
dönüş;
}
uart-> ( "SK") göndermek;
uBit.display.scroll ( "SK");
}
void processBLEUart () {
uint8_t readBuf [22];
ise sonsuza dek (1) {// döngü
if ((! bağlı) || (! uart-> isReadable ())) {
uBit.sleep (50); // 50ms bekleyin ve tekrar kontrol
devam et; // Döngü;
}
// Başka türlü bağlanır VE okumak için bazı giriş var
Eğer (uart-> isReadable ()) {
ise (uart-> isReadable ()) {
int charCount = uart-> okumak (readBuf, 22, ASYNC);
if (charCount! = 0) {
for (int i = 0; i uBit.display.scroll ((CHar) readBuf [i]);
}
}
}
}
}
/ *
ÖNEMLİ !!!
Oherwise bellek tükeneceğini!
Burada gerekli değildir çünkü MicroBitConfig.h içinde DAÜ ve Etkinlik hizmetleri devre dışı bırakmanızı öneririz:
microbit-> MICROBIT-dal-> nunun> core> MicroBitConfig.h
#define MICROBIT_BLE_DFU_SERVICE 0
#define MICROBIT_BLE_EVENT_SERVICE 0
#define MICROBIT_SD_GATT_TABLE_SIZE 0x500
* /
Main () int
{
bit runtime: Mikro initialism //.
uBit.init ();
uBit.messageBus.listen (MICROBIT_ID_BLE, MICROBIT_BLE_EVT_CONNECTED, onConnected);
uBit.messageBus.listen (MICROBIT_ID_BLE, MICROBIT_BLE_EVT_DISCONNECTED, onDisconnected);
uBit.messageBus.listen (MICROBIT_ID_BUTTON_A, MICROBIT_BUTTON_EVT_CLICK, onButtonA);
uBit.messageBus.listen (MICROBIT_ID_BUTTON_B, MICROBIT_BUTTON_EVT_CLICK, onButtonB);
uBit.messageBus.listen (MICROBIT_ID_BUTTON_AB, MICROBIT_BUTTON_EVT_CLICK, onButtonAB);
UART = Yeni MicroBitUARTService (* uBit.ble, 32, 32);
uBit.display.scroll ( "git");
create_fiber (ve processBLEUart); // Lif oluşturmak ve bunu planlayın.
release_fiber ();
}
Kurulum Talimatları
APK Dosyası Nedir?
Android Package Kit sözcüklerinin kısaltılmışı olan APK, Android uygulamalarını dağıtmakta ve yüklemekte kullanılan bir format. APK dosyası, cihazınızda yüklemeye yapmak için gerekli tüm öğeleri barındırır. Windows'taki EXE dosyaları gibi herhangi bir APK dosyasını Android'li cihazınıza kopyalayıp, onu kendiniz yükleyebilirsiniz. Uygulamaları bu şekilde elle yüklemeye "sideloading" deniyor.
Bilgisayarda .APK Nasıl Açılır
BlueStacks, Windows işletim sistemine sahip bilgisayarlar üzerinde Android oyunlarını oynamak veya Android uygulamalarını çalıştırmak için kullanabileceğiniz ücretsiz bir Android simülatörüdür.
- BlueStacks'i yukarıdaki bağlantı adresine tıklayarak hemen ücretsiz olarak indirebilirsiniz. İndir Bluestacks
- Programı indirdikten sonra nereye indirdiyseniz ikonuna çift tıklayarak kurulum ekranına geçiş yapmalı ve ilk karşılaştığınız sayfada sağ alttaki devam et tuşuna tıklayıp kurulum işlemlerini tamamlamanız gerekiyor.
- İndirdiğiniz APK’yı sağ tuş < - Birlikte Aç - > Bluestacks olarak çalıştırıp yükleyin.
- Artık bilgisayarınız üzerinden micro:bit Gateway heyecanına ulaşabilirsiniz.
Android Cihaza .Apk Nasıl Yüklenir?
Bunları yükleyebilmek için cihazımıza ekstra bir .Apk yükleyici indirmemiz gerekiyor. Android işletim sistemine sahip olan tüm cihazlarda standart olan bu uygulamayı sizde her cihazınızda sorun yaşamadan kullanabilirsiniz.
- Cihazınızın "Ayarlar" menüsüne giriş yapın.
- Ayarlar penceresindeki "Güvenlik" bölümüne giriş yapın.
- Güvenlik ayarları sayfasında yer alan "Bilinmeyen kaynaklar" seçeneğini işaretleyin.
- Artık APK uzantılı dosyaları çalıştırarak Play Store haricinden oyun ve uygulama yükleyebilirsiniz.
Önceki versiyonlar
Yorumlar
(*) is required
Benzer
Ferdinand Stueckler'dan Daha Fazla
Üst Sıralar